0584 – ἀποδείκνυμι (apodeiknumi)

approve


Type:
Verb
Greek: ἀποδείκνυμι (apodeiknumi)
Pronunciation: ap-od-ike-noo-mee    Listen
Gematria: 690(1 + 80 + 70 + 4 + 5 + 10 + 20 + 50 + 400 + 40 + 10)    words with the same gematria
Origin: From G0575 and G1166
Usage: 4 times in NT

Description

  1. To point away from one's self, to point out, show forth, to expose to view, exhibit.
  2. To declare, to show, to prove what kind of person anyone is, to prove by arguments, demonstrate.


Origin

From G0575 and G1166:

ἀπόapoG0575from
δεικνύωdeiknuoG1166show
